New Milford, CT Apartments for Rent
Nestled along the banks of the Housatonic River, New Milford combines historic charm with contemporary living in this picturesque Connecticut town. As the largest town in Connecticut by land area, New Milford features a historic downtown centered around one of the longest town greens in the state, where seasonal festivals, farmers markets, and community gatherings take place throughout the year. With an average rent of $1,809 for a one-bedroom apartment, the area offers value while providing access to scenic landscapes, including the northeastern shore of Candlewood Lake.
New Milford's location, 50 miles west of Hartford and approximately 80 miles from Manhattan, provides convenient access to major metropolitan areas. The town encompasses several distinct neighborhoods including Gaylordsville, Northville, and the historic town center, with apartments available throughout these areas. Recreation opportunities abound with three rivers, hiking trails, and the developing New Milford River Trail, which winds through local parks and green spaces.
